Block

#23,073,358
Block Number
23,073,358 @ 10/24/2025, 24:03:10
Status
Finalized
ID
0x0160124e8cd0df4bcb170acf47ea4e2b449b0a8bbe2bbe685480328f6ec23553
Transactions
Gas Used
2487298/40000000 (6.22% Used)
Base Fee
10,000 Gwei
Total Score
2,254,139,856 (+97)
Rewards
0.75 VTHO